LEVINE, SAM

LEVINE, SAM is a Texas gas lease in Leon County, Railroad Commission district 05, operated by Roberts & Hammack, Inc. It has 1 wellbore on file with the Commission. Reported production runs from January 1993 to August 2026, totalling 463,535 thousand cubic feet. The lease is currently producing. Fitting a decline curve to that history and pricing the remaining production at today's forward curve values the whole lease — a 100% undivided interest — at about $70K, with roughly $11K expected over the next twelve months. An individual royalty owner receives their own decimal interest times that figure. Over the last twelve months on file it averaged 560 thousand cubic feet a month. Its strongest month on the record we hold was December 2017, at 1,306 thousand cubic feet. In our own backtest, leases producing at this rate are forecast to within about 22% of what they went on to produce, and that measured error is the range shown on the page rather than a confidence of our own devising.
